Ground Floor Accommodation:

Accessed via a convenient timber door set into the gable wall, the first floor opens into a welcoming hallway that includes a downstairs WC and a spacious utility room, complete with fitted cupboards and worktops—ideal for practical day-to-day living.

The heart of the home is the generous kitchen-dining room, featuring parquet flooring, a range of fitted base and wall units, a double high-level electric oven, and ample space for entertaining. Large timber-framed double-glazed windows frame stunning views of Ingleborough, making every meal a scenic experience.

Stretching the full width of the property, the living room offers a cosy retreat with a substantial log-burning stove and double-glazed doors that open into a bright, south-facing conservatory. With a tiled floor and half-height glazed walls, the conservatory provides the most impressive vantage point of Ingleborough within the home. Externally:

The property benefits from a large, enclosed south facing lawn and paved garden with commanding views towards the distinctive hill of Ingleborough which offers an ideal space for summer entertaining. The detached single storey garage located on the opposite side of the quite public highway provides a hugely useful and secure storage space.

For those seeking a little extra land, an adjoining 0.58-acre parcel of agricultural pasture is available by separate negotiation. This offers an excellent opportunity for buyers interested in a small paddock conveniently located near the property.

Services:

The property benefits from mains water and electricity supplies. Heating is provided by an oil boiler with the ground floor being heated by underfloor heating and the first floor being heated by wall mounted radiators. Sewage drainage is via a private ‘Klargester’ style package treatment plant located within the garden of the property. The property is understood to benefit from a ‘B4RN’ fibre optic internet connection.

Easements, Wayleaves and Rights of Way:

The property is sold subject to, and with the benefit of, all existing wayleaves, easements, and rights of way, whether public or private, and whether specifically mentioned or not. It is understood that a private right of way exists across the patio located to the south of the property, benefiting the adjacent property known as ‘Chapel House’. This right of way is believed to be limited to pedestrian access for maintenance purposes only. We are not aware of any public rights of way affecting the property.
